Transponder Keys

If you own a car that was built within the past 20 years It is likely that your key is equipped with transponder chips inside. These chips are used as an extra security feature to your vehicle, to stop theft. The engine control unit sends it a coded message each time you insert the transponder key in the ignition. If the code matches, the car will begin to move.

The benefit of a transponder's key is that it can't be duplicated by most copying machines. This doesn't mean the key is safe from theft. A skilled criminal can connect a car to a hot wire that has a transponder installed.

Transponder keys are slightly more expensive than other types of replacement keys, but they have more security and features. If you're concerned about preventing your vehicle from being stolen It could be worth the extra cost.

Fob Keys

Fob keys generate an electronic code that, if matched by the computer in the car, opens doors and then starts the engine. Although they are practical and safe however, replacing them could be expensive, especially when the only one you have is lost.

The process varies by manufacturer, Mazda Replacement Keys but a majority of them provide instructions in their owner's manuals or on their websites. A key fob replacement cost can vary from $50 up to $300, not including the price of a mechanical backup key. This is why it's important to have a spare key fob ready. If you're in search for a new car Many used-car dealers will offer a higher price in case the vehicle has two functioning remotes.

Key fob batteries last around a year, so it's crucial to replace them before they expire. A dead battery could stop your key fob from unlocking or even start the vehicle.

A depleted cell may cause buttons on your key fobs to stop working making it difficult to get in or out of your vehicle.
